Welcome to this beautifully preserved detached period property, nestled in the heart of Worthing.
Ideally situated within easy reach of the town centre, mainline railway station, and seafront, this elegant home blends timeless character with practical family living.
The property retains many original features, including sash windows, ceiling roses, ornate coving, cast iron fireplaces, and stained glass. It comprises three spacious reception rooms, including a formal living room, a flexible study with access to the garden, and a bright dining room—each full of period charm and individual character.
The kitchen is both functional and stylish, fitted with a range of units, an enamel sink, gas hob, integrated oven, and space for appliances.
French doors in both the study and dining room lead directly to the garden, creating a lovely indoor-outdoor flow.
Upstairs, the main bedroom is exceptionally large, featuring dual sash windows, a stone fireplace, ceiling rose, and elegant original detailing.
The second and third bedrooms are also generously sized, one with a charming exposed brick fireplace and both enjoying views over the rear garden.
The bathroom is a standout feature, offering a freestanding roll top bath, a separate shower cubicle, wash basin, and a classic feel throughout. A separate W.C. with side window completes the upper floor.
The property boasts a wall-enclosed, south-facing courtyard garden that offers privacy and plenty of sunlight throughout the day. It is paved with attractive flower and shrub borders and includes convenient side access.
This rarely available home is perfect for lovers of character and history, offering superb proportions and an enviable central location. Early viewing is highly recommended.
